Output 792c523a8036b13673331a94ef403fa95fa6517cd47d004f3bb22bfabca0ff9a:0

value
254522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f652da1b71fd837b5392552ef6bf2c237de6fc OP_EQUAL
address
3HNGZDKwoZ98hr3ZYSgv1DPCsJZp7Waoub
transaction
792c523a8036b13673331a94ef403fa95fa6517cd47d004f3bb22bfabca0ff9a
confirmations
274422
spent
true